Abstract

Throughout the development of communication technology that has a crucial role in today’s society, forms of media have been expanding worldwide. Specifically for South Korea with its advanced entertainment industry, mass productions of fictional stories that resonate with the targeted audience are displayed through mass communication media, such as films, as a tool to represent cultures. This research uses the qualitative approach. Data collection is carried out through documentation obtained from scenes in “Parasite” (2019) film, and literature analysis from articles, journals, books and other online sources. Data analysis is then conducted through the use of Roland Barthes’ semiotics theory and satire techniques. The result of this research provides the knowledge and understanding of social satire presented throughout the storyline of the film. The social reality of the stratified classes struggles in capitalist culture that exists in South Korea is indirectly critiqued by the director and screenwriter Bong Joon-ho, through the verbal and non-verbal cues portrayed¬ in such exaggerated, contrasting, and ironic ways. / Sepanjang perkembangan teknologi komunikasi yang memiliki peran penting dalam masyarakat saat ini, berbagai bentuk media telah bermunculan di seluruh dunia.
